Ontario conducted its latest Provincial Nominee Program (PNP) draw on March 7, 2024, targeting the Human Capital Priorities stream. A substantial total of 2,104 Invitations to Apply (ITAs) were granted to eligible candidates, showcasing the province’s commitment to attracting skilled individuals.

The Comprehensive Ranking System (CRS) cutoff for this draw ranged between 352 and 421, emphasizing Ontario’s focus on diversity in skills and experiences.
Details of the Human Capital Priorities Stream Draw:
• Date of Draw: March 7, 2024
• Number of ITAs: 2,104
• CRS Score Range: 352-421
